
Vamos a explorar los tipos de bases de datos relacionales y sus características. Dividiremos el problema en partes más pequeñas para facilitar la comprensión.
Parte 1: ¿Qué es una Base de Datos Relacional?
Una base de datos relacional es un tipo de base de datos que organiza datos en tablas. Estas tablas están relacionadas entre sí. La relación se basa en claves comunes.
Las tablas consisten en filas (registros) y columnas (campos). Cada fila representa una entidad única. Cada columna representa un atributo de esa entidad.
Must Read
Parte 2: Características Clave de las Bases de Datos Relacionales
Las bases de datos relacionales tienen varias características importantes. Estas características aseguran la integridad y la consistencia de los datos. Veamos algunas de ellas.
Integridad referencial: Asegura que las relaciones entre las tablas sean válidas. Impide la eliminación o modificación de registros relacionados si esto viola las reglas establecidas. Mantiene la consistencia de los datos.
Normalización: Proceso de organizar los datos para reducir la redundancia. Minimiza la dependencia entre las tablas. Mejora la integridad de los datos.

ACID: Acrónimo de Atomicidad, Consistencia, Aislamiento y Durabilidad. Describe las propiedades que garantizan transacciones de bases de datos fiables. Asegura que las operaciones se realicen de manera completa y segura.
Parte 3: Tipos de Bases de Datos Relacionales y Ejemplos
Existen diferentes sistemas de gestión de bases de datos relacionales (SGBDR). Cada uno con sus propias características y peculiaridades. Exploraremos algunos de los más comunes.
MySQL: Un SGBDR de código abierto muy popular. Es conocido por su velocidad y fiabilidad. Se utiliza en muchas aplicaciones web.
PostgreSQL: Otro SGBDR de código abierto con una gran cantidad de características. Soporta una amplia variedad de tipos de datos. Es conocido por su cumplimiento de los estándares SQL.

Oracle Database: Un SGBDR comercial muy potente. Ofrece una amplia gama de funcionalidades y herramientas. Es utilizado en grandes empresas.
Microsoft SQL Server: Otro SGBDR comercial desarrollado por Microsoft. Está integrado con el ecosistema de Microsoft. Ofrece herramientas de análisis y reporting.
SQLite: Una base de datos relacional embebida. Es ligera y fácil de usar. Se utiliza en dispositivos móviles y aplicaciones de escritorio.

Parte 4: Comparación de Características Específicas
Cada SGBDR tiene sus propias fortalezas y debilidades. La elección del SGBDR adecuado depende de las necesidades del proyecto. Consideraremos algunos aspectos clave.
Escalabilidad: Capacidad del sistema para manejar un aumento en la carga de trabajo. Algunos SGBDR son más escalables que otros. Esto es crucial para aplicaciones con mucho tráfico.
Rendimiento: Velocidad con la que el sistema puede procesar las consultas. El rendimiento depende de la optimización de la base de datos. También depende de la infraestructura subyacente.
Costo: El costo de la licencia y el mantenimiento del SGBDR. Las opciones de código abierto son gratuitas. Las opciones comerciales pueden ser costosas.

Facilidad de uso: Facilidad con la que se puede administrar y utilizar el SGBDR. Algunos SGBDR tienen interfaces gráficas más intuitivas. Otros requieren más conocimientos técnicos.
Parte 5: Conclusión
Hemos explorado los tipos de bases de datos relacionales y sus características. Hemos examinado algunos de los SGBDR más populares. Hemos considerado los factores a tener en cuenta al elegir un SGBDR.
La elección del SGBDR correcto es crucial para el éxito de un proyecto. Comprender las características y las diferencias entre los SGBDR es fundamental. Permite tomar decisiones informadas.
Las bases de datos relacionales siguen siendo una tecnología fundamental. Son utilizadas en una amplia variedad de aplicaciones. Su capacidad para organizar y gestionar datos de forma eficiente las hace indispensables.